Prolonged cloaca opening by Turbulent-Builder-86 in kingsnakes

[–]AdImaginary6175 2 points3 points  (0 children)

Feeding in cage does not lead to food aggression whatsoever and it’s been proven time and time again, also transferring to feed is not only extremely stressful but also potentially harmful for the snake, you should absolutely never handle and snake after feeding as they can regurgitate and hurt themselves really badly. Substrate is fine aslong as you use the right stuff, a standard ABG mix for a bioactive is just fine, remember in the wild they don’t have anything to clean off dirt…. Look into tap training, my brooks comes to the glass whenever I tell him it’s feeding time and doesn’t when I don’t, never bit or struck at me once ever and I feed exclusively in the cage

So I am just about to get my king snake. Do in need to quarantine him? by Exotic-Translator186 in kingsnakes

[–]AdImaginary6175 2 points3 points  (0 children)

Mites are fairly obvious and so are the wounds they cause, if you don’t see any deformed scales, open wounds, lifted scales (like a mite is under it) it should be just fine, unless it was a wild or extremely underkept snake I wouldn’t worry about it and possibly going through the steps to quarantine my cause more stress than needed and cause more harm than good especially if it’s a really young snake and is trying to find its rhythm
